Seguidores

lunes, 8 de mayo de 2023

Aplicar diseño de sistema mediante las diferentes partes que forman sus técnicas

Tema                     clase 2

              El diseño

Clase 1


¿Que es el diseño? "Diseño computacional:?

 es un método de diseño que utiliza una combinación de algoritmos y parámetros para resolver problemas de diseñocon procesamiento informático avanzado.




Cada paso del proceso de un diseñador se traduce a un lenguaje informático codificado. El programa de software utiliza esta información junto con parámetros específicos del proyecto para crear algoritmos que generan modelos o análisis de diseño. Una vez que se completa la programación inicial, el diseño se convierte en un proceso dinámico y repetible.


Los ordenadores  y el software, ahora utilizados de manera muy común en la arquitectura, sorprendieron al sector cuando fueron introducidos en la industria a finales de los años 80. Ahora, 30 años después, el diseño computacional está listo para hacer un cambio parecido en la forma en que diseñamos porque se basa en confiar en algoritmos y análisis humano con inteligencia artificial.


En este post, veremos más en detalle qué es diseño computacional y sus ventajas. Y si quieres saber más de este tema, puedes estudiar el Summer Course in Architecture, en inglés, en la Universidad Europea, un curso de dos semanas que empieza en julio, con nuestro partner, Bartlett B-Pro.


Diseño computacional: Definición

El diseño computacional es un método de diseño que utiliza una combinación de algoritmos y parámetros para resolver problemas de diseño con procesamiento informático avanzado.


Cada paso del proceso de un diseñador se traduce a un lenguaje informático codificado. El programa de software utiliza esta información junto con parámetros específicos del proyecto para crear algoritmos que generan modelos o análisis de diseño. Una vez que se completa la programación inicial, el diseño se convierte en un proceso dinámico y repetible.


Tradicionalmente, el diseño es algo pasivo: un diseñador usa su conocimiento e intuición para crear diseños con un programa de diseño asistido por ordenador (computer-aided design o CAD en inglés). Este método de dibujo manual limita el número de opciones de diseño que se pueden considerar y está restringido por el tiempo y los recursos disponibles. Una vez implementado, el diseño computacional es una herramienta eficaz y útil para aumentar la productividad y crear diseños más robustos.


Tipos de diseño computacional

El diseño computacional está evolucionando y cambiando a medida que se establecen estándares dentro del campo. Tal como está actualmente, hay tres tipos de diseño computacional: diseño paramétrico, diseño generativo y diseño algorítmico.


Diseño paramétrico

El diseño paramétrico es un proceso de diseño interactivo que utiliza un conjunto de reglas y parámetros para controlar un modelo de diseño. Las reglas establecen la relación entre los diferentes elementos del diseño. Los parámetros son valores específicos que definen el modelo de diseño, como dimensiones, ángulos y pesos. Cuando se modifica un parámetro, los algoritmos actualizan automáticamente todos los elementos de diseño asociados en función de las dependencias establecidas.


Diseño generativo

El diseño generativo es un proceso de diseño que utiliza entradas definidas por el usuario para producir múltiples conceptos de diseño que cumplen objetivos específicos. Las entradas son reglas y parámetros que definen los requisitos de diseño, de forma parecida al diseño paramétrico. Con el diseño generativo, el usuario también ingresa métricas de éxito que evaluarán los resultados. La inteligencia artificial (IA) y la computación en la nube generan decenas o incluso cientos de opciones de diseño, clasificadas según estas métricas.


Diseño algorítmico

El diseño algorítmico es un método de diseño guiado por algoritmos. El término a menudo se usa indistintamente con diseño computacional y podría considerarse un tipo de diseño generativo. El diseño algorítmico utiliza algoritmos, un conjunto de instrucciones que determinan la solución a un problema, para producir modelos arquitectónicos.


Ventajas del diseño computacional

Como que es un campo relativamente nuevo, cada vez hay más ventajas según va avanzando y creciendo el uso de diseño computacional. A continuación, te explicamos algunas de las ventajas:


Mejores diseños y soluciones: los diseñadores pueden explorar cientos de opciones de diseño en lugar de solo las pocas que producirían utilizando el dibujo manual. También pueden aprovechar las soluciones de diseño únicas generadas por los algoritmos porque se pueden refinar para mejorar continuamente los resultados.

Automatizar tareas repetitivas: actualizar una dimensión es fácil cuando solo se aplica a un elemento, pero se vuelve tedioso cuando es necesario en cientos de elementos. Con herramientas de diseño computacional conectadas al software, un diseñador puede crear un algoritmo que modifique todo el modelo en tiempo real.

Reducir costes: utilizar herramientas de diseño computacional requiere menos personal para un proyecto. Además, los diseños producidos por los algoritmos tendrán menos errores, lo que reduce la probabilidad de cambios más adelante. Con menos recursos y cambios, los costes de los proyectos se reducirán.

Mejor productividad: Con el diseño computacional, los arquitectos pueden diseñar más rápido con menos iteraciones, mejorando la productividad y logrando más con menos recursos.

Tarea de informática #1jovanny

 Ofimática

 Tarea de informática #1jovanny

...John David...
Tarea#2



 Instrucciones:

En programación, una instrucción simplemente es la indicación o directiva que le dice al computador que haga algo. Piensa en ella como una orden, comando o sentencia. En Scratch, cualquier bloque cuya etiqueta se lea como una orden, es una instrucción.

 las expresiones:

 d+. Las expresiones son secuencias de operadores y operandos que se utilizan para uno o más de estos propósitos:


Calcular un valor a partir de los operandos.


Designar objetos o funciones.


Generar “efectos secundarios”. (Los efectos secundarios son cualquier acción distinta de la evaluación de la expresión; por ejemplo, modificando el valor de un objeto).


En C++, los operadores se pueden sobrecargar y el usuario puede definir sus significados. Sin embargo, la prioridad y el número de operandos que aceptan no pueden modificarse. En esta sección se describe la sintaxis y la semántica de los operadores tal como se proporcionan con el lenguaje, no sobrecargados. Además de los tipos de expresiones y la semántica de las expresiones, se tratan los siguientes temas:


Expresiones primarias


Operador de resolución de ámbito


Expresiones de postfijo


Expresiones con operadores unarios


Expresiones con operadores binarios


Operador condicional


Expresiones constantes


Operadores de conversión


Información de tipos en tiempo de ejecución


Temas sobre operadores en otras secciones:


Operadores integrados de C++, precedencia y asociatividad


Operadores sobrecargados


typeid (C++/CLI)


Nota


Los operadores para los tipos integrados no se pueden sobrecargar; su comportamiento está predefinido.

archivo:

  es una secuencia de bytes almacenados en un dispositivo. Un archivo es identificado por un nombre y la descripción de la carpeta o directorio que lo contiene. A los archivos informáticos se les llama así porque son los equivalentes digitales de los archivos escritos en expedientes, tarjetas, libretas, papel o microfichas del entorno de oficina tradicional.

Jerarquía de archivos

Son los elementos agrupados en directorios, que a su vez se organizan en una jerarquía. En la cima de la jerarquía está el directorio "raíz", representado por "/".


Como se muestra en el ejemplo de la Figura 3-1, cada directorio del sistema de archivos puede incluir muchos otros directorios. La convención consiste en distinguir niveles de directorio mediante el carácter /. Teniendo esto en cuenta, observe que el directorio/ (raíz) contiene entre otros los subdirectorios /usr, /bin, /home y /lib. El subdirectorio /home contiene user1, user2, y user3.





Sistema informático y sus características:

Los sistemas informáticos pueden definirse como el propio equipo de cómputo con su sistema y software de aplicación y medios de almacenamiento electrónico, redes de área local y redes de área amplia.

Características de los sistemas informáticos
Para cualquier sistema, se pueden distinguir cuatro características básicas de los sistemas informáticos:

Relación costo / rendimiento
Fiabilidad y tolerancia a los fallos
Escalabilidad
Compatibilidad y movilidad del software


Gracias por visitarnos:

•me gustaría que te suscríbas al link de mi canal de Youtube para que no te pierdas mi contenido musical 👇

https://youtu.be/2eaONtD73tQhttps://youtu.be/2eaONtD73tQ

Aplicar diseño de sistema mediante las diferentes partes que forman sus técnicas

Tema                     clase 2               El diseño Clase 1 ¿Que es el diseño? "Diseño computacional:?   es un método de diseño q...